Key Features of the xbox wireless controller
This model arrives in the sleek xbox controller carbon black finish, featuring sculpted surfaces and refined geometry that sit naturally in your hands. The shape prioritizes comfort, making it an ideal textured grip controller for both casual players and competitive gamers who spend hours at a time.
The new hybrid D-pad delivers precise directional inputs, whether you are navigating menus, executing fighting game combos, or playing 2D platformers. This upgrade over the standard D-pad is one of the most praised improvements among longtime Xbox fans.
Built as a true textured grip controller, this product features non-slip surfaces on the triggers, bumpers, and back case. These grip improvements keep your hands firmly in place even during the most intense gaming moments.
The xbox controller share button makes it effortless to capture screenshots, record gameplay clips, and share content directly from the pad. Content creators and streamers will find this single addition a genuine quality-of-life upgrade.
With a remarkable 40-hour battery life, this product keeps you gaming for days before needing a battery swap. It uses standard AA batteries, which means no waiting for a recharge — just grab fresh batteries and keep playing.
Both xbox controller Bluetooth and proprietary Xbox Wireless technology are built in, so pairing with Xbox Series X|S, Windows PCs, Android, iOS, Fire TV Sticks, Smart TVs, and VR Headsets is fast and hassle-free. This USB-C gamepad supports direct plug-and-play connectivity via its USB-C port on both console and PC, eliminating the need for proprietary cables. The 3.5mm headset jack at the bottom lets you plug in any compatible wired headset for private audio or team chat.
Custom button mapping is fully supported through the free Xbox Accessories app on Windows and Xbox consoles. This makes this product highly adaptable for different game genres and playstyles, letting you configure every button to your exact preference.

How It Compares to Alternatives
Compared to the Sony DualSense, this model offers significantly broader cross-platform compatibility, particularly for PC, Android, and iOS users. However, Sony’s controller does edge ahead with its haptic feedback and adaptive trigger technology for PlayStation exclusives.
Against 8BitDo’s Pro 2 Bluetooth game controller, this Xbox product wins on native ecosystem integration and Xbox Game Pass compatibility. Both are excellent third-party and first-party options, but Microsoft’s solution remains the strongest pick for Xbox-primary gamers.
The previous generation Xbox controller lacked both a USB-C port and a share button — two features this upgraded USB-C gamepad addresses directly. It retains the same proven ergonomic layout that gamers already love, now with meaningful modern upgrades. Frequently Asked Questions
Q: What platforms are compatible with this gaming controller?
This product supports Xbox Series X|S, Xbox One, Windows 10/11 PCs, Android, iOS, Fire TV Sticks, Smart TVs, and VR Headsets. Connectivity is handled via both Xbox Wireless and Bluetooth protocols for maximum flexibility.
Q: How long does the battery last in real-world use?
In our testing, the 40-hour battery life was accurate under moderate gaming conditions. Vibration-intensive games may reduce this slightly, so keeping a spare set of AA batteries on hand is always recommended.
Q: Does this model support custom button mapping?
Yes, custom button mapping is fully supported through the free Xbox Accessories app available on Windows and Xbox consoles. You can remap every button and save multiple profiles with ease.
Q: What wireless connectivity options does this product support?
The xbox wireless controller uses both proprietary Xbox Wireless technology and standard Bluetooth connectivity, allowing seamless pairing with consoles, PCs, mobile devices, and smart TVs. According to Microsoft’s official store listing, no additional adapter is required for most supported platforms.
Q: Is there a 3.5mm headset jack on this product?
Yes, this model includes a 3.5mm headset jack, allowing you to plug in any compatible wired headset directly for private listening or game chat. This is especially useful when gaming late at night.
Q: Does it work with the Xbox Accessories app?
Absolutely. The Xbox Accessories app unlocks custom button mapping, controller profiles, and firmware updates on both Xbox consoles and Windows PCs. It is a free download and takes just minutes to configure.
